湖南广播电视大学2012年7月期末考试英语口语(3)模拟试题英语口语(3)口试题签(学生用卷 1A)In this test, you will have an opportunity to demonstrate your ability to understand and use spoken English. The test is divided into three parts. Part 1 Questions and Answers. Part 2 Role-play. Part 3 Mini-talk. Part 1 Answer the questions the examiner asks you. Part 2 Complete a role-play task with your conversation partner, using the information provided in the following box. You have 4 minutes for this part. Student A and Student B are flat-mates. They are discussing As troubles. The following is the procedure you should follow. Tell B something about your job or your studies or your routine daily life. Say you are bored with the present condition (Boredom); Say you understand B, but insist that you have reached the limit of your patience / capability / energy (Insisting); Agree / disagree to follow Bs advice , explaining why (Concession); Agree / disagree to have a fun day together over the weekend. Ask if it is possible to invite more people to the fun activity B suggests or suggest a different time / activity (Possibi1ity). Part 3 Speak on the following topics for 2-3 minutes. One mans treasure is another mans junk. Do you agree or disagree with this statement? Use examples to illustrate your point. 英语口语(3)口试题签(学生用卷 1B)In this test, you will have an opportunity to demonstrate your ability to understand and use spoken English. Use examples to illustrate your point.英语口语(3)口试题签(教师用卷 1)In this test, the students will have an opportunity to demonstrate their ability to understand and use spoken English. The test is divided into three parts. Part 1 Questions and Answers. Part 2 Role-play. Part 3 Mini-talk. Part 1 Ask each student two different questions from the following list. Each student has about 1. 5 minutes. 1.What effects may the use / overuse of mobile phones have on peoples lives? 2.Does the web play an important role in your life? Why or why not? 3.Many people wish “Happy New Year” to their relatives and friends through SMS (手机短信). Are you one of them? Why or why not? 4.What are the main entertainment facilities in your hometown? Are you a frequent goer? Why or why not? Part 2 Students A and B will complete a role-play task. Their conversation should last 4 minutes. Student A and Student B are flat-mates. They are discussing As troubles. The Following is the procedure you should follow. Student AStudent B Tell B something about your job or your studies or your routine daily life. Say you are bored with the present condition (Boredom); Say you understand B, but insist that you have reached the limit of your patience / capability / energy (Insisting); Agree / disagree to follow Bs advice , explaining why (Concession); Agree / disagree to have a fun day together over the weekend. Ask if it is possible to invite more people to the fun activity B suggests or suggest a different time / activity (Possibi1ity). Say that A needs to think more of the positive aspects of As life (job / studies / daily life, etc.) (Necessity); Persuade A to make a self-help pan, giving relevant and detailed suggestions (such as spending more time with As family or friends or work harder, or 1ivng a more healthier life, etc. (Urging); Suggest having a fun day together over the weekend. Ask what would be a perfect meal / day / way of relaxation for A. (Persuading); List ways you can enjoy the weekend together (Reassuring and exemplifying).
